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air Cost In Oceanview, VA
The cost of hardwood floor water damage repair can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Oceanview, VA. We’ll provide you with a free estimate and guide you through the process. Here are some estimated costs for different aspects of the repair: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Inspection and assessment | $100-$300 | Severity of damage, size of affected area |
| Drying and extraction | $500-$2,000 | Amount of water, type of equipment needed |
| Repair or replacement | $1,000-$5,000 | Size of affected area, type of flooring |
| Refinishing | $500-$2,000 | Size of affected area, type of finish |
